Visit to Solent Coastguard
By Jean Sandell

Thirteen members and friends met on a bright Sunday morning in May outside a large imposing white house on the seafront at Lee on the Solent, now home to Solent Coastguard. We were welcomed by Veronica, one of HM Coastguard officers and shown into the downstairs dining room, now the lecture room. For the next 20 minutes we were shown a video explaining the wide duties and diverse work of the Maritime and Coastguard Agency (MCA).
Upstairs we were shown the major incident room, with four computer and communication stations for use by emergency services and any other organisations involved. There were shelves and shelves of files containing contingency plans for all foreseeable major incidents, the largest being for Fawley. Next door was the operations room, where the day to day work is done. Each computer terminal provided all essential information. A touch of the screen brought up further information and controlled radios and telephones. They could even bring up all Portland CG information and control their operations.
It was very interesting to see them at work and put faces to the voices we hear on the radio. They welcomed other club members to visit, so maybe another trip could be arranged. Many thanks to Kath and Chris Rayner for organising this one.
